We report on an ongoing effort to determine the hadronic vacuum polarization contribution to the anomalous magnetic moment of the tau from lattice QCD. The calculation is based on CLS ensembles with $N_f=2+1$ flavours of $O(a)$-improved Wilson fermions, covering five lattice spacings and a range of pion masses, including the physical point. Because of the short-distance nature of this observable, particular attention is given to the control of cutoff effects and to the continuum extrapolation, together with other sources of systematic uncertainty. We present preliminary results for the leading-order hadronic vacuum polarization contribution to the tau anomalous magnetic moment and discuss the status of the full error budget.
